Output 70b83f53617c42e7a38cbe16172a5e9f2c852f0a59853656bcfe24342ddbf8eb:7

value
340000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1dd80d7d2c03e9f69566474f67292a1ab77ad4ab OP_EQUALVERIFY OP_CHECKSIG
address
13ioRAhbQpAyPeBWuAXpchqLdTVVbCndvU
transaction
70b83f53617c42e7a38cbe16172a5e9f2c852f0a59853656bcfe24342ddbf8eb
spent
true